Louise Daugherty (Genomics England Curator)

Comment on list classification: Keep gene status as Red until evidence of reported cases. Currently there is no evidence to suggest PRKG1 causes a phenotype that would fit this panel. However, it is important to note that PRKG1 (Protein Kinase, CGMP-Dependent, Type I) is involved in the Platelet activation, signaling and aggregation pathway.
